Abstract
► Significant microbial reduction was observed during the ramping and holding time. ► A greater reduction was observed with a higher temperature and a longer time. ► Hydrothermal treatment of 120 °C for 40 min was sufficient to achieve sterilization. ► Hydrothermal treatment is effective to sterilize the Chinese food waste.
